How can I get 900 CIBIL score?

It generally takes a few months to improve your CIBIL score. To move the digits closer to 900, make sure to pay your bills on time and in full, keep credit utilization low, maintain the right mix of secured and unsecured loans and avoid making too many credit inquiries in a short span of time.

Can I get loan if my CIBIL score is 600?

While you may still be able to get a personal loan with a credit score between 600 and 700, the lower your score, the lower your approved loan amount will be. A credit score below 600 is considered inadequate for personal loans in most cases.

What increases credit score?

Factors that contribute to a higher credit score include a history of on-time payments, low balances on your credit cards, a mix of different credit card and loan accounts, older credit accounts, and minimal inquiries for new credit.
